在Spring框架中,Context是一个环境对象,它代表了应用程序的运行环境,可以获取应用程序中的各种资源,比如Bean、配置文件等。Spring中的Context可以分为不同的类型,如应用上下文(...
Spring Data MongoDB是Spring Data项目的一个模块,用于简化使用MongoDB数据库的开发。使用Spring Data MongoDB,可以通过简单的配置和使用Reposit...
在Spring框架中,可以使用Spring Data JPA来实现分页查询。Spring Data JPA提供了`Pageable`接口和`Page`接口来支持分页查询。 要实现分页查询,需要在Re...
在Spring中,可以通过实现ControllerAdvice注解来实现全局异常处理。具体步骤如下: 1. 创建一个全局异常处理类,例如GlobalExceptionHandler: ```jav...
可以通过Spring提供的ApplicationContext接口来查看Spring容器中的对象。ApplicationContext接口提供了多个方法来获取容器中的对象,包括根据bean的名称、类型...
1. 通过构造方法创建:在配置文件中配置Bean的类路径和属性值,Spring容器会通过反射调用Bean的构造方法来创建对象。 2. 通过静态工厂方法创建:通过配置文件配置Bean的类路径和调用静态...
要在Spring框架中获取数据库连接对象,可以通过Spring JDBC或Spring Data JPA来实现。以下是两种方法: 1. 使用Spring JDBC: 首先需要在Spring配置文件中...
Spring创建Bean的过程可以分为以下几个步骤: 1. Spring容器启动:当Spring容器启动时,会读取配置文件中的Bean定义信息,包括Bean的类名、属性值等。 2. 实例化Bean...
1. 在XML配置文件中使用标签定义和配置Bean 2. 使用@Component、@Service、@Repository、@Controller等注解标注Bean类,然后在配置类中使用@Compo...
在Spring Boot中,可以通过自定义注解来标记启动类,在启动类上添加该自定义注解,然后通过扫描该注解来启动Spring Boot应用程序。 以下是一个简单的示例: 首先创建一个自定义注解 `...